Transaction ecbe4a2860b2ab6150b6b936e84e7e6151c54b664b59ec2e2002f1a897879457
1 Input
1 Output
-
ecbe4a2860b2ab6150b6b936e84e7e6151c54b664b59ec2e2002f1a897879457:0
- value
- 413538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c90b59dc5fa0655526ee2c1648f90c2ff70bd61 OP_EQUAL
- address
- 3Jt4KCKQ6K9o9XbEJnaBkb2HzrvJN6cxqH